How can I adjust my calorie intake to support my strength training program, such as StrongLifts, for optimal muscle growth and performance?

To support your strength training program like StrongLifts for optimal muscle growth and performance, adjust your calorie intake by consuming slightly more calories than your body needs to maintain weight. This will provide the energy and nutrients necessary for muscle repair and growth. Focus on consuming a balance of protein, carbohydrates, and healthy fats to support your workouts and recovery. Monitor your progress and adjust your calorie intake as needed to achieve your muscle-building goals.
